Bonnie Elaine Foster, 82, passed away at her Damascus, Maryland home on Wednesday, September 28, 2022, with her family by her side.

Born June 16, 1940, in Purdum, Maryland, she was the daughter of the late Glenwood and Virginia King.

She graduated from Damascus High School in 1958 and soon married the late Delmas R. Foster, her husband for 57 years.

While her daughters were in school, Bonnie was a devoted mother and housewife.  She volunteered in the cafeteria at Woodfield Elementary School and was a co-leader of a local Girl Scout troop.  Bonnie taught Sunday School and Bible School at Bethesda United Methodist Church for many years.

After the girls graduated from high school, she went to work for Blatchley Nationwide Insurance agency where she worked as an office manager and agent for over 20 years.

She and Delmas spent a lot of time at their house on the bay in Rock Hall, Maryland enjoying the sun and relaxing with family and close friends.

She is survived by her daughters, Penny Foster of Damascus and Tammy Israel and her husband James of Victoria, Minnesota; her grandchildren, Janelle Averill, Daniel Foster and his wife Caroline, Brooke, Taylor and Megan Israel, and Nicole Padgett and her husband Chris as well as four great grandchildren.

She is also survived by her sister, Judy Knoll, her husband Tom and their family.
